Transaction 0372989be32cb9212ef1a0cb002bb54433f11329a7028ba4dd5155c03a8630fc
1 Input
2 Outputs
- 0372989be32cb9212ef1a0cb002bb54433f11329a7028ba4dd5155c03a8630fc:0
- 0372989be32cb9212ef1a0cb002bb54433f11329a7028ba4dd5155c03a8630fc:1
value 6390000
address 15xsp45GePsZVDyfJKJgzowJ5hgx7pye2Y
value 1500000
address 17RmsZVhhT9kRv3tYj59jLy1PFC8mXEhJb